Partnering with SAS

Your sponsorship of SAS helps to cover the costs of our Travel Season and the Savon's Higher Opportunity Organizational Training (S.H.O.O.T.) Leadership Program [workshops and events]. Beyond just financial support, we also invite our partners to go the extra mile to educate and the SAS student athletes about their business or any knowledge they have to offer our students through workshops. The goals and objectives of sponsorships are specifically intended for Community Outreach to educate our student athletes and teach them about how to maintain a GPA of 3.0 and about financial responsibilities.  While playing in Basketball Tournaments and Fundraising to accomplish goals, the players will build relationships with opposing teams while they develop a love to accomplish goals in their lifetime using basketball and their community resources as they enter adulthood.

community impact

SAS impacts a over 630 students since 2009 in the Competitive and Recreational Programs, and an additional 400 children per year in Royal Palm Beach’s Recreational Basketball Program, camps, and early release and holidays from school.   The Village of Royal Palm Beach has worked exclusively with Savon's Academy Stars to be the provider for their competitive basketball programs which allows us to positively impact and enhance the health and welfare of over 3,000 children.

St. Thomas Initiative

As a testimony to the power and benefit of partnering with Savon's Academy Stars, here is how a current partnership with St. Thomas University has provided mutually beneficial results.

Savon’s Academy Stars is currently involved with the St. Thomas Initiative.

SAS actively encourages our student athletes to add St. Thomas Initiatives as one of our standards. Once our program director learned of the University we began promoting St. Thomas to our students, parents, and fans of our program.  We also promote St. Thomas in our brochure and on our website. Our student athletes recently gained even more interest in St. Thomas when Patrick Gayle [STU Men's Basketball Head Coach] attended a practice session on March 17th at the Royal Palm Beach recreation Center and spoke to our teams.  Through committed partnerships such as this, our goal is to develop relationships with many other colleges and universities throughout the country.
